How Our Portable Pump Water Extraction Service Works
When you call us for Portable Pump Water Extraction, you’re not just getting a team of technicians, you’re getting a dedicated project manager who’ll guide you through every step of the process. We’ll assess the damage, develop a customized plan, and execute it with precision and care.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will arrive at your property within 60 minutes and assess the extent of the damage. They’ll identify the source of the water, measure the affected area, and develop a detailed plan to extract the water and dry the space.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use portable pumps to extract standing water from your property.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and ensuring a successful drying process.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, we’ll use industrial-strength dehumidifiers and air movers to dry your property thoroughly.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ring a healthy environment.
Step 4: Monitoring and Cleaning
Our team will monitor your property daily to ensure that the drying process is progressing as planned. We’ll also clean and disinfect all affected areas to prevent bacterial growth and unpleasant odors.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certificate
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your property is dry and safe. We’ll provide you with a certificate of completion and a satisfaction guarantee.

Portable Pump Water Extraction Cost in West Park, ID
The cost of Portable Pump Water Extraction in West Park, ID will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are competitive, and we offer free estimates to help you plan your bud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the job and the number of technicians required. |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water to be extracted and the equipment required.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the number of dehumidifiers required. |
| Monitoring and Cleaning | $100 – $500 | The frequency of monitoring and the extent of cleaning required. |
| Final Inspection and Certificate | $50 – $200 | The complexity of the job and the number of technicians required. |
